发明名称 SLACK ADJUSTER MECHANISM FOR TREAD BRAKE APPARATUS
摘要 This invention relates to a slack adjuster mechanism for a tread brake apparatus used for braking a railway car wheel. A fluid pressure operated piston transmits a braking force to a brake shoe through an actuating lever and a brake rod which comprises a screw and a nut about which is disposed a slack adjuster mechanism that embodies a ratchet secured to the nut and a pawl that is operated by a linkage that includes a bell-crank lever that is pivotally mounted at the junction of its arcuate-shaped arm and bifurcated arm on a slack adjuster stem driver carried by an operating stem that constitutes one member of this linkage. The arcuate-shaped arm of the bell-crank lever abuts a roller carried by a stationary bracket, and one end of the bifurcated arm carries a roller that abuts a stop formed on a slack adjuster ring disposed in surrounding relation to the brake rod and anchored to the brake actuating lever to be movable therewith so that this movable stop constitutes a fulcrum about which the bell-crank lever is rocked as the bracket roller rolls along the arcuate surface of the arcuate-shaped arm when a brake application is effected to cause downward movement of the junction of the lever arms thereby, via the stem driver, the operating stem, which extends through the bifurcated arm, and other members of the linkage actuating the pawl and ratchet to take up slack upon effecting a brake release if the shoe clearance is excessive.
